Liara Name: Complete Etymology, Meaning & Popularity Analysis
Summary
Liara is a modern English name that likely combines elements from other names such as 'Lia' and 'Sara'. It means 'light bringer' and has evolved from various historical forms. While it does not have biblical relevance, it has gained popularity in recent years, especially in fantasy contexts. Variants include Lia, Leah, and Sara. Liara is currently viewed as a unique name, with notable recognition through fictional characters.

"Liara" Popularity Across American Generations
Generation | Gender | Rank | Total Names |
---|---|---|---|
Millennials (Gen Y) (1981-1996) | Girl | 23525th of 27321 | 10 |
Generation Z (Gen Z or Zoomers) (1997-2012) | Girl | 13231st of 35406 | 99 |
Generation Alpha (2013-2024) | Girl | 3186th of 30306 | 612 |
